My suggestion? Call the Karuizawa Prince Hotel:

 

http://www.princejapan.com/KaruizawaPrinceHotel/index.asp

 

...and ask them whether they can arrange an English instructor for you as day visitors (it's their little resort, close to the station, that we guess you'll be skiing on). Even if they can't arrange their own instructor, I'm sure they'll be able to suggest someone else who can.
